The Holy Monastery of Saint Nectarios in Aegina is one of the most important pilgrimage sites in Orthodoxy, attracting thousands of visitors from Greece and abroad every year. Located about 6 kilometers from the port of Aegina, it rests in a peaceful natural environment that exudes serenity and devotion.

✨ History & Holy Relics

The monastery was founded in the early 20th century by Saint Nectarios, who restored the old convent of the Holy Trinity and lived there during his final years. Today, visitors can pay their respects at his tomb and holy relics, as well as visit the very cell where he lived and worked.

🏛️ Architecture & The Imposing Church

The imposing church, one of the largest in the Balkans, dominates the monastery complex and serves as a landmark for the island. Beyond its religious significance, the monastery stands out for its unique architecture and the profound sense of calm it offers every visitor.
